@charset "utf-8";
/* CSS Document */
.ny_bd{
	width:100%;
	height:auto;
	float:left;
}
.ny_index{
	width:1002px;
	height:auto;
	margin:0 auto;
	display: table;
}
.ny_left{
	width:240px;
	height:auto;
	float:left;
	background:url(../images/leftbg.jpg) no-repeat right;
	display: inline;
	
}
.sidebar_top{
	width:211px;
	margin-left:9px;
	float: left;
	margin-top: 30px;
	background:#034893; 
    height:10px;
	/* Gecko browsers */
-moz-border-radius-topleft: 20px;
-moz-border-radius-topright: 20px;
-moz-border-radius-bottomleft: 0;
-moz-border-radius-bottomright: 0 ;
 
/* Webkit browsers */
-webkit-border-top-left-radius: 20px;
-webkit-border-top-right-radius: 20px;
-webkit-border-bottom-left-radius: 0;
-webkit-border-bottom-right-radius: 0;
 
/* W3C syntax */
border-top-left-radius: 20px;
border-top-right-radius: 20px;
border-bottom-right-radius: 0;
border-bottom-left-radius:  0;
	
}
.sidebar{
	width:211px;
	margin-left:9px;
	float: left;
	overflow:hidden;
	text-align:justify;
	
	
	
}

.sidebar ul{}
.sidebar ul li{
	background:url(../images/leftnav.jpg);
}
.sidebar ul li a{
	height:34px;
	line-height:35px;
	display:block;
	text-decoration:none;
	color:#333;
	text-align:justify;
	padding-left:55px;
	
	
}
.sidebar ul li a:hover{
	color:#333;
	padding-left:55px;
	display:block;
	height:34px;
	line-height:35px;
	text-decoration:none;
	text-align:justify;
	font-weight:bold;
	
}
.sidebar ul li a.click{
	color:#333;
	padding-left:55px;
	text-align:justify;
	height:34px;
	line-height:35px;
	text-decoration:none;
	font-weight:bold;
	
}	
.left_midd{
	width:199px;
	height:79px;
	float:left;
	margin-left:15px;
	margin-top:10px;
	margin-right: 29px;
}
.left_bottom{
	width:199px;
	height:140px;
	float:left;
	margin-left:15px;
	margin-top:10px;
	font-size:12px;
	color:#666;
	line-height:24px;
	text-align:left;
	margin-bottom: 10px;
}
.left_bottom a{
    font-size:12px;
	color:#666;
}
.ny_right{
	width:710px;
	height:auto;
	float:right;
	display: inline;
	
}
.ny_right_top{
	width:710px;
	height:72px;
	float:left;
	background:url(../images/news_04.jpg);
}
.ny_right_top_left{
	width:400px;
	height:30px;
	float:left;
	margin:35px 0 0 30px;
	font-size:16px;
	font-family:"楷体";
	font-weight:bold;
	color:#000;
	line-height:20px;
}
.ny_right_top_right{
	width:230px;
	height:30px;
	margin:35px 15px 0 0;
	font-size:12px;
	color:#999;
	line-height:24px;
	float: right;
	text-align: right;
}
.ny_right_top_right a{
	
	font-size:12px;
	color:#999;
	line-height:24px;
}
.ny_right_hot{
	width:710px;
	float:left;
	height:170px;
}
.ny_right_hot_img{
	width:197px;
	height:130px;
	float:left;
	margin:20px;
}
.ny_right_hot_in{
	width:475px;
	height:130px;
	float:left;
	margin:20px 0;
}
.ny_right_hot_title{
	width:420px;
	height:20px;
	float:left;
	margin-top:25px;
}
.ny_right_hot_title a{
	font-size:14px;
	color:#333;
	background:url(../images/new.png) no-repeat right;
	font-weight: bold;
	padding-right: 35px;
}
.ny_right_hot_content{
	width:420px;
	height:75px;
	float:left;
	font-size:12px;
	color:#999;
	line-height:24px;
}
.ny_right_hot_bottom{
	width:70px;
	height:20px;
	float:right;
	margin-right:50px;
	margin-top: 10px;
	-moz-border-radiust: 5px;
    -webkit-border-radius: 5px;
     border-radius: 5px;
	 background:#e8130b;
	 text-align:center;
	 line-height:20px;
}
.ny_right_hot_bottom a{
	font-size:12px;
	color:#FFF;
}
.ny_right_list{
	width:695px;
	height:330px;
	border-bottom:dashed 1px #CCC;
	border-top:dashed 1px #CCC;
	float: left;
	margin-left: 15px;
	padding-top: 20px;
}
.ny_right_list ul{
}
.ny_right_list ul li{
	width:710px;
	height:35px;
	float:left;
	line-height: 30px;
}
.ny_right_list ul li a{
	font-size:12px;
	padding-left:25px;
	background:url(../images/dd1.png) no-repeat left;
	color:#333;
	float:left;
}
.ny_right_list ul li span{
	float:right;
	font-size:12px;
	color:#333;
	padding-right:30px;
}
.ny_right_page{
	width:710px;
	height:50px;
	float:left;
}
.ny_right_page_in{
	width:375px;
	height:40px;
	margin:12px auto;
	font-size:12px;
	color:#999;
	text-align:center;
}
.ny_right_page_in a{
	font-size:12px;
	color:#999;
	text-align:center;
}
.ny_photolist{
	width:710px;
	height:auto;
	border-bottom:dashed 1px #CCC;
	margin-left: 15px;
	float:left;
}
.ny_photolist_photo{
	width:220px;
	height:180px;
	float:left;
	margin:12px 0 12px 12px;
}
.ny_photolist_img{
	width:210px;
	height:112px;
	margin:7px auto;
}
.ny_photolist_img_title{
	width:210px;
	height:36px;
	margin:0 auto;
	text-align:center;
}
.ny_photolist_img_title a{
	font-size:12px;
	color:#333;
	line-height:16px;
}
.ny_only_title{
	width:710px;
	height:54px;
	margin-left:15px;
       margin-top:15px;
      margin-bottom:10px;
	float:left;
	font-size:18px;
	color:#900;
	text-align: center;
	font-weight: bold;
}
.ny_only_content{
	width:695px;
	height:auto;
	margin-left:15px;
	margin-bottom:15px;
	float:left;
	line-height:24px;
	color:#333;
	font-size:15px;
